Akron Children’s, University of Akron Partner to Offer Free Nursing Degree
Akron Children’s Hospital and the University of Akron have partnered to address the nursing shortage by offering a free Associate of Applied Science in Nursing, or ADN, degree through the Akron Children’s Career Launch Program.
Starting in January 2025, 30 students will receive prepaid tuition, along with funding for uniforms, books and supplies, in exchange for a 2-3-year work commitment at Akron Children’s Hospital. The ADN program, funded by a $1.5 million investment from Akron Children’s, provides students with a faster path to becoming registered nurses with specialized training in pediatric care. Classroom lectures are available at University of Akron campuses in Akron and Medina, as well as via livestream, while labs and clinicals will be held locally.
